Secret Santa has been a tradition for the past two years for me and my friends. "Cuchumbos" is the typical Honduran way to say Secret Santa. For our annual Secret Santa dinner, we all get dolled up and enjoy a taste of a Christmas inspired dinner. This year, we decided to only include girls in the Secret Santa because of previous problems with guys not taking the whole thing seriously. Nevertheless, it was a hilarious Christmas dinner. I honestly think my gift was the best gift ever. One of my friends (which we've been classmates only once in sixth grade) gave me this whole baking kit that included a bowl, a whisk, cookie cutters, and more! Following the "cuchumbo," we had turkey-ish chicken with stuffing, potato salad, and green salad for dinner. For desert, one of my friends baked these mouth-watering mini key lime pies that were definitely the highlight of the night.
